Believe it or not it's almost time to start thinking about Fall maintenance.
If your pond is in an area where there are a lot of falling leaves you may want to think about having it netted before the leaves start to fall. Covering your pond with a net does not mean you can't still enjoy it. Here's a perfect example of how a pond can still look great even with a net on it.
